linux环境安装tomcat(内含安装文件)

说明

本文受众主要是初次在linux环境下安装tomcat的开发人员或实施人员。以下是辅助工具和安装包(jdk和tomcat)下载地址:

  1. jdk:jdk-8u181-linux-x64.tar.gz
    下载地址:https://pan.baidu.com/s/1pZtyx4XU3UlqQk8BCmMxAA 提取码:zrlo;
  2. tomcat:jdk-8u181-linux-x64.tar.gz
    下载地址:https://pan.baidu.com/s/1SwXAn4lipHUUDgN7ABlisQ 提取码:hnwv;
  3. WinSCP下载地址https://winscp.net/eng/download.php
  4. Xshell6下载地址https://pan.baidu.com/s/1kci9YLameoI01HmohYRAkg 提取码:a42q;

一、安装辅助工具

我们借助于两个工具Xshell6和WinSCP分别用来输入linux终端命令以及查看文件结构,借助于图形化文件软件WinSCP,我们可以直接在文件目录里面新建文件和复制本地文件,更加符合windows用户的操作习惯。连接好的Xshell6和WinSCP如图所示:
在这里插入图片描述
在这里插入图片描述

二、安装jdk和tomcat

1、解压安装jdk。

将jdk的包放在usr/java中。

直接在WinSCP的usr目录中右键新建一个“java”目录,进入java目录,右键复制粘贴下图中的jdk压缩包到java目录中。如下图标红处所示。
在这里插入图片描述
在这里插入图片描述

解压jdk

Xshell执行命令cd /usr/java至java目录下(如下图)
输入tar -xvf jdk-8u181-linux-x64.tar.gz解压刚复制进去的jdk的包
右键刷新WinSCP中的java目录,可以看到如上图所示目录,证明解压成功。
在这里插入图片描述

2、解压安装tomcat。

将tomcat的包放在/usr/tomcat中。

直接在WinSCP的usr目录中右键新建一个“tomcat”目录,进入tomcat目录,右键复制粘贴下图中的tomcat压缩包到tomcat目录中。如下图标红处所示。
在这里插入图片描述

解压tomcat。

Xshell执行命令cd /usr/tomcat至tomcat目录下(如下图)
输入tar -xvf apache-tomcat-8.5.39.tar.gz解压刚复制进去的tomcat的包
右键刷新WinSCP中的tomcat目录,可以看到如上图所示目录,证明解压成功。
在这里插入图片描述

3、配置jdk和tomcat环境。

Xshell输入命令vim /etc/profile打开配置文件(你们目前没有标红区域的文字,这是我配置jdk环境和tomcat环境后的样子),通过键盘控制光标到标红区域处,复制下列内容进去(如下图)。复制完后,通过键盘上的“Esc”键退出编辑模式,输入:wq保存退出,然后执行命令source /etc/profile”(目的是使修改的文件生效)。复制内容如下:

export JAVA_HOME=/usr/java/jdk1.8.0_181
export CATALINA_HOME=/usr/tomcat/apache-tomcat-8.5.39
export PATH=$PATH:$JAVA_HOME/bin:$CATALINA_HOME/bin
export CLASSPATH=.:$JAVA_HOME/lib:$CATALINA_HOME/lib
export JAVA_HOME PATH CLASSPATH CATALINA_HOME
注意:有的服务器上显示下列内容乱码,这个时候可以手动在/etc目录中打开profile文件,编辑后保存。
在这里插入图片描述

三、启动tomcat

Xshell执行命令cd /usr/tomcat/apache-tomcat-8.5.39/bin进入tomcat下的bin目录,输入命令./startup.sh启动服务(./shutdown.sh是关闭服务),windows浏览器网址输入 自己的ip:8080 查看tomcat是否成功安装。如下图所示则安装成功。如若不成功。则显示网址访问失败,有几种原因,一般是linux防火墙未关闭。在这里插入图片描述

四、关闭linux防火墙

Xshell执行下列命令,此时再刷新刚打开的ip:8080,即可看到启动成功。
iptables -F
ptables -P INPUT ACCEPT

五、部署web项目

WinSCP中进入tomcat下的webapps目录中,复制粘贴自己的web项目,根据相应的 ip:端口/xx项目 访问即可。

六、参考

本文参考博客(如有侵权,告知立删)

https://www.cnblogs.com/taojietaoge/p/10692557.html

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值